Presently the Blord Group has a range of five promising products that are doing well in the tech market.

Bitshop is a digital wallet for storing all your digital assets like Bitcoin, Usdt, ETH and many more.

 

BillPoint provides a bill payment platform where you can buy cheap data, airtime, electricity tokens, and access major service providers.

 

Famous is an app used to elevate your online presence. This app enables you increase your followers, get more likes, views and everything needed to give you visibility online. Visibility is premium to any member of the online community.

 

JetPay app is a p2p platform where you trade all your digital assets. It is flexible and easy to use, yet guarantees security of your digital assets.

 

Dolla app is an app that generates a Dolla Card used in making online purchases. It can be used to shop on international websites, pay for subscriptions like Netflix, amazon and the likes of them.
